    For anyone that wants to do this it is very simple:<br />
    <br />
    1: Open up your image in photoshop and make a copy of it by selecting the image, copying it, opening a new document and pasting the image. At this point you should have two exact images open.<br />
    <br />
    2: on the first image go to Image -&gt; Image size. Within the Image size window make sure that the Constraim Proportion is unchecked. Go the the Width size and select Percent from the right. Now reduce the width to 50%. Some images are weird and you may have to do 45% or even 40%.<br />
    <br />
    At this pint your call will be completey shrunk in width.<br />
    <br />
    3: now go to the copied image and select the eiliptical select tool. Select around each wheel and copy it on your shrunked image. Make sure the copy creates a layer. You will do this once for each wheel. Each wheel will need to reside on its on layer. Once copied you can position the wheel where it looks best.<br />
    <br />
    4: Select the Erase tool and make sure it is selected with the brush option. You can select a brush of around 10 pixels. Now make sure that you are on one of the wheel layers and start to erase around the wheel deleting parts that do not match up until it blends in. Do the same thing for the other wheel by going to the second wheel layer. Once you have erased around the wheel the wheels should blend in seamlessly. You may have to move the wheel layer a little more to make it match up better.<br />
    <br />
    5: once you are satisifed you can use the Save For web option to save a JPG image, or the file -&gt; save as JPG.<br />
    <br />
    6: you should now have a micro race car of your very own! I do this on Photoshop 7, but it should be the same on other versions of photoshop. Better to have a side shot of your car since the angle shots are a pain to do and require a lot more work.<br />
